In this episode of In Between Sundays, we’re kicking off a 3-part series on fear by tackling one of the most universal struggles: the fear of change.
We dive into Joshua 1, laugh through personal stories (yes, including a mouse panic and a dancing avocado tattoo), and get honest about what it means to be strong and courageous in a world that constantly shifts around us.
Whether you’re stepping into a new season or clinging to stability, this conversation will remind you:
Courage isn’t about being fearless—it’s about being connected.
Topics We Cover:
Why “fear not” is misunderstood
Joshua’s terrifying promotion
Fight, flight, freeze, or fawn—how we each respond to fear
When calling feels like the last thing you wanted
How to tell if God is leading… or if you’re just restless
The power of community in seasons of uncertainty
